1. Product Overview
Petroleum pipes are high-performance industrial piping systems engineered for the safe and efficient transportation of crude oil, refined petroleum products, and associated hydrocarbons. Designed to withstand extreme pressures, temperatures, and corrosive environments, they are critical components across upstream, midstream, and downstream oil and gas operations. 2. Key Specifications & Technical Characteristics
- Material Composition: Carbon steel, alloy steel, stainless steel (grades such as API 5L, ASTM A106, ASTM A53)
- Grade: API-certified grades (e.g., X42, X52, X65, X70) depending on application requirements
- Physical Characteristics:
- Form: Seamless or welded pipes
- Surface: Black, galvanized, or coated (3LPE, FBE, anti-corrosion coatings)
- Diameter Range: ½ inch to 60 inches
- Wall Thickness: SCH 10 to SCH 160 and above
- Mechanical Properties: High tensile strength, impact resistance, and corrosion resistance
- Packaging Options: Bundled with steel straps, plastic caps on ends, or customized export packaging
- Shelf Life: Indefinite under proper storage conditions (protected from moisture and corrosion)
